El Faro de Las Cabezas de San Juan
El Faro de Las Cabezas de San Juan is a lighthouse located in the historic area north of Fajardo near Las Croabas. It was built in 1892 and served as a navigation aid for ships traveling in the Atlantic Ocean and the Caribbean Sea. The lighthouse is now a popular tourist attraction and provides scenic views of the surrounding area.
Catedral Santiago Apóstol
The Catedral Santiago Apóstol is a Roman Catholic cathedral in Plaza Pública de Fajardo. The cathedral is known for its contemporary architectural design and prominent town location. It is a popular place of worship for the local community and attracts visitors from around the region.
Laguna Grande Bio Bay
This bio bay has a long history, dating back to the Taíno indigenous people. They used the bioluminescence of the bay as a source of light and for religious rituals. In the late 20th century, the development of tourism brought more attention to the bio bay, and it became a popular tourist attraction. Today, Laguna Grande is protected as a natural reserve, and efforts are made to maintain its ecological health and preserve its bioluminescent display for future generations.
Hacienda Chocolat
This cacao farm was established to revive the traditional chocolate-making methods of Puerto Rico and to bring attention to the island’s rich chocolate-making history. The hacienda offers tours and tastings for visitors, showcasing the process of making artisanal chocolate using locally sourced cocoa beans and traditional techniques. Over the years, Hacienda Chocolat has become a tourist destination and a symbol of Puerto Rico’s chocolate heritage.
